Often hailed as the "Lady Superstar" of Kollywood, Simran has maintained a luminous presence in Indian cinema for over three decades. Known for her exceptional dancing skills, emotional depth, and versatility, she has delivered iconic performances across Tamil, Telugu, and Hindi films. Simran’s Iconic Tamil Filmography

Simran’s Tamil career began in 1997 with a trio of hits—Once More, V.I.P., and Nerrukku Ner—which instantly earned her the Filmfare Award for Best Female Debut – South. Career Milestones & Major Hits

Thulladha Manamum Thullum (1999): Playing a blind woman opposite Vijay, Simran won the Tamil Nadu State Film Award for Best Actress. Her performance is widely regarded as one of the best portrayals of a visually impaired character in Tamil cinema.

Vaalee (1999): A career turning point where she starred alongside Ajith Kumar. Her portrayal of Priya won her the Cinema Express Award for Best Actress.

Parthen Rasithen (2000): Simran stunned audiences by taking on a negative role at the peak of her stardom. Her performance as the antagonist Banu received unanimous critical acclaim.

Kannathil Muthamittal (2002): Directed by Mani Ratnam, she played the resilient mother of an adopted child. This role earned her the Filmfare Award for Best Actress – Tamil.

Vaaranam Aayiram (2008): After a brief hiatus following her marriage, she made a powerful comeback playing both the wife and mother of Suriya’s characters, winning another Filmfare Award for Best Supporting Actress.

Andhagan (2024): In this remake of Andhadhun, her portrayal of the antagonist "Simi" earned her the Best Actress Critic Award at the JFW Movie Awards. Recent Work & OTT Debuts

Simran has successfully transitioned into the digital era with notable projects:

Paava Kadhaigal (2020): Her streaming debut on Netflix, where she received positive reviews for her performance in the segment "Oru Iravu".

Rocketry: The Nambi Effect (2022): Reunited with R. Madhavan for this trilingual biographical drama.

Mahaan (2022): Starred alongside Vikram in this Amazon Prime Video release.

Tiger 3 (2023): Appeared in a pivotal role as the Prime Minister of Pakistan. Popular Videos & Chartbuster Songs

Simran Bagga: The "Lady Superstar" of Kollywood Simran Bagga, born Rishibala Naval, is a prolific Indian actress, producer, and dancer who has defined eras of South Indian cinema. Often hailed as the "Lady Superstar" of Kollywood, she transitioned from a glamorous debutante to a powerhouse performer known for her incredible versatility and dancing prowess. Career Overview and Early Success

Noticed first as an anchor on the show Superhit Muqabla by Jaya Bachchan, Simran made her Bollywood debut in Sanam Harjai (1995). However, her career truly ignited in the Tamil and Telugu industries. She made a splashing Tamil debut in 1997 with back-to-back hits Once More, V.I.P., and Nerrukku Ner, earning the Filmfare Award for Best Female Debut – South. Simran's Iconic Filmography
